Saffir-Simpson scaleUtilizing the Saffir Simmons hurricane scale in the classification of hurricanes, hurricanes are placed into five categories according to wind speed. The hurricanes that sustain sustained winds of 74-95 miles per an hour have been classified as Category 1, for those that reach 150 miles/hour are classified as Category 5.
The scale for hurricanes is utilized mostly throughout North America. It's used in assessing the strength of tropical storms in the Atlantic as well as North Pacific oceans. The scale is utilized to assess the strength of hurricanes and calculate the damage that they can cause to property.
The scale used to measure hurricane intensity is an United Nations project that was altered in the 1970s from Robert Simpson, a meteorologist. In the early 1970s, this scale was utilized for forecasting hurricanes throughout the United States and was also used to warn the public regarding the impact of hurricanes.

How to prepare for a hurricaneMaking sure you are prepared for a hurricane is one of the best ways to protect your life and your property. Initial steps are to listen to the forecast for the weather. Then you can create a checklist to prepare for hurricanes along with a hurricane supply kit.
When a storm is threatening, you should stay inside and stay out of windows. There may be a need to evacuate. However, you must wait for official notices regarding the threat before leaving. This will give you ample time to prepare.
If you're in a zone of hurricanes, you must begin to familiarize yourself with the shelters in your area. You should also stock your refrigerator and freezer with water. You must also prepare a plan for meeting with family members in case you have to leave.
The hurricane season begins June 1 until November 30. The weather is unpredictable , and forecasts can change very quickly. It is important to check your home insurance to ensure that you have enough coverage.
